To remove the front indicator on a Rover 75, start by opening the hood and locating the indicator assembly. You may need to remove the headlight unit by unscrewing the retaining bolts and gently pulling it out. Once the headlight is free, you can access the indicator bulb holder; twist it counterclockwise to release and remove the indicator light. Finally, replace or reinstall the indicator as needed.

Access indicator flasher under instrument panel left of steering column. Remove screw retaining indicator flasher to instrument panel. To replace the front wing indicator on a Mercedes C 200, first, ensure the vehicle is turned off and parked on a level surface. Remove the screws or clips securing the front wheel arch liner to gain access to the indicator assembly. Disconnect the wiring harness from the old indicator, remove it from the wing, and then install the new indicator by reversing the steps. Finally, secure the wheel arch liner back in place and test the new indicator to ensure it functions properly.

To change the rear indicator bulb on a Vectra, first, open the trunk and locate the access panel on the side where the bulb needs replacement. Remove the panel by unscrewing or unclipping it, then twist the bulb holder counterclockwise to release it. Pull out the old bulb and insert a new one, ensuring it's securely in place, then reassemble the bulb holder and access panel. Finally, test the indicator to ensure it’s working properly.
